Senior Technical Program Manager - Open Systems Technologies
New York, NY 10004
About the Job
A financial firm is looking for a Senior Technical Program Manager to join their team in New York, NY.
Pay: $69/hr W2
This position is hybrid with 3-4 days onsite.
Responsibilities:
Program Leadership:
o Develop and execute a comprehensive program strategy for the segregation of production and non-production network environments.
o Provide leadership and guidance to cross-functional teams throughout all phases of the program.
o Define program objectives, scope, deliverables, and timelines.
Network Architecture:
o Collaborate with network & systems engineers and architect to develop detailed network designs and configurations.
o Help evaluate and recommend network technologies, tools, and solutions to support segregation requirements.
Security Compliance:
o Ensure compliance with industry standards regulations, and best practices related to network security and segregation.
o Implement robust security controls and protocols to protect sensitive data and prevent unauthorized access.
o Support regular audits and assessments to monitor compliance and identify areas for improvement.
Risk Management:
o Identify potential risks and vulnerabilities associated with network segregation efforts.
o Develop risk mitigation strategies and contingency plans to address identified risks.
o Monitor and track risk factors throughout the program lifecycle, implementing proactive measures to minimize risk exposure.
Stakeholder Management:
o Collaborate with key stakeholders, including IT teams, security experts and business leaders to gather requirements and align program objective with organizational goals.
o Communicate program status, updates, and milestones to stakeholder though regular reporting and presentations.
o Address stakeholder concerns and prioritize feedback to ensure successful program delivery.
Qualifications:
• Bachelor's degree in Electrical and/or Computer engineering, Computer Science, Information Technology or related field.
• 8+ years of experience in network architecture, design, and implementation.
• Proven track record of successfully leading large-scale network segregation programs or similar initiatives.
• Ability to deal with ambiguity and define approaches to bring un-focused issues to resolution.
• Excellent leadership, communication, presentation, and interpersonal skills; ability to act as a bridge between multiple businesses and technology areas.
• Strong sense of ownership and accountability for work
• Strong understanding of network protocols, security principles, and best practices.
• Experience with network infrastructure technologies, such as routers, switches, firewall, load balancers, server farms, systems, and cloud.
• Ability to multitask and prioritize; ability to work under pressure and within tight deadlines.
• Experience working with project management tools such as Jira, ensuring effective tracking and management of program tasks and deliverables.
• PMP, CCNA, CISSP, or other relevant certifications preferred.
